Medical associtation honours Ayurvedic physician

Dr Jawahar Dhir honoured with Lifetime Achievement Award

The Phagwara branch of the National Integrated Medical Association (NIMA) has conferred a Lifetime Achievement Award on renowned author and senior Ayurvedic physician Dr Jawahar Dhir at a ceremony held under the chairmanship of NIMA president Dr Neeraj Abbhi.

The honour was presented to Dr Dhir in recognition of his recent national and international accolades, including the “Dhanvantari Award – 2025” bestowed by the Punjab Government’s Ayurvedic Department and the international literary distinction “Vishva Hindi Sahitya Sadhna Vibhushanam” awarded by the UK-based Hindi magazine Kavitavali.

Speaking on the occasion, Dr Neeraj Abbhi said Dr Dhir’s achievements both as a distinguished writer and a successful physician had brought pride not only to the medical fraternity but also to Punjab and the international literary community.

“It is an honour for NIMA that Dr Dhir is one of its senior-most members. His accomplishments inspire us all,” he added.

Expressing gratitude, Dr Jawahar Dhir said, “NIMA is like my family and receiving this honour on this platform is a moment of great pride for me.”

Former NIMA Phagwara president Dr Yash Chopra highlighted Dr Dhir’s contributions, noting that 17 of his books have been published so far.

He recalled that Dr Dhir had earlier been felicitated by former Prime Minister Atal Bihari Vajpayee.

The recent honours received by Dr Dhir are a matter of pride not just for NIMA but for the entire city of Phagwara, he added.

During the ceremony, Dr Dhir was presented with a shawl, memento and pen by senior doctors, including Dr Neeraj Abbhi, Dr Amit Sharma, Dr Nikhil Khosla, Dr BS Bhatia, Dr Ramanjit Singh Kinda, Dr Vivek Mahajan, Dr Rakesh Khosla and Dr Ajay Ohri.

The event was attended by a large number of doctors, including NIMA Women’s Forum chairperson Dr Anubha Ohri.
